Actionable Steps You Can Take Today:
- Define Your Goals: Before seeking a mentor, clearly articulate what you want to achieve. What skills need development? What career paths are you exploring?
- Research Potential Mentors: Don’t limit yourself to those assigned. Identify leaders whose careers you admire and proactively reach out (respectfully, of course!).
- Prepare Thoughtful Questions: Avoid generic inquiries. Demonstrate you’ve thought about your challenges and are seeking specific guidance.
- Follow Through: Mentorship isn’t a one-time event. Schedule regular check-ins and actively implement the advice you receive.
- Document Your Journey: Keep a record of your learnings, challenges, and successes. This self-reflection is invaluable.
